Gate at bridleway passage through dry stone wall
Gate at bridleway passage through dry stone wall
The wall lies on the south side of Gill Beck, a tributary of the River Greta, its groove shows as a dark line above the gate. The vague rise beyond the trees is named on OS maps as Hurst Hill - a very minor feature.
